Among the earnings stories for Tuesday, May 13, from AP Financial News:
Top stories:
BOSTON (AP) -TJX Cos. says its first-quarter profit rose nearly 20 percent as it continues to draw shoppers increasingly looking for bargains in a tough economy.
AMSTERDAM, Netherlands (AP) -The bank and insurance company Fortis NV said Tuesday its first-quarter earnings fell by 31 percent, as its investments soured and assets declined in value amid market turmoil.
Other stories:
PALO ALTO, Calif. (AP) -Hewlett-Packard Co.'s fiscal second-quarter earnings exceeded expectations and the company raised its full-year financial targets, the computer maker and technology services provider said Tuesday.
EL PASO, Texas (AP) -Western Refining Inc. said Tuesday it swung to a first-quarter loss, as surging crude oil prices and other rising costs more than offset the independent refiner's soaring revenue.
NEW YORK (AP) -Online gaming company GigaMedia Ltd. said Tuesday its first-quarter profit rose on an increase in gaming software sales.
NEW YORK (AP) -Shares of Canadian Solar Inc. surged in premarket trading Tuesday after solar cell maker swung to a profit in the first-quarter on a big increase in its European business.
EL PASO, Texas (AP) -Personal-care and household-products company Helen of Troy Ltd. said Tuesday its fourth-quarter profit jumped 6 percent, helped by tax and litigation settlement gains.
